Embodiment Construction

[0024] In one aspect of the invention, the radiation source providing the electromagnetic radiation of the manipulation beam and the radiation source providing the electromagnetic radiation of the sensing beam may be the same emission source.

[0025] In an alternative aspect of the invention, the radiation source providing the operating beam and the radiation source providing the sensing beam may be independent of each other, ie at least two independent electromagnetic radiation emitting sources.

[0026] If the radiation source for manipulating the beam and the radiation source for sensing the beam are provided by a single source of electromagnetic radiation, the radiation source according to one aspect of the invention may include a beam splitter to split the radiation emitted from the actual emitter Divided into a sensing beam and an operating beam.

Abstract

The invention provides a light emitting device. The light emitting device is provided with at least one radiation source; at least one radiation source for electromagnetic radiation providing at least one sensing beam during operation of the device; at least one detector for detecting the sensing beam; at least one sensing window having a contact boundary surface, wherein the detector is arranged such that during operation of the device the sensing beam on a path from the radiation source providing the sensing beam to the detector is at least once reflected at the contact boundary surface of a sensing window by total internal reflection once the contact boundary surface of the sensing window is in contact with air; and a controller communicating with the radiation source providing the operating beam and with a detector and being operable to influence operation of the radiation source providing the operating beam responsive to the sensing beam detected at the detector.

technical field [0001] The invention relates to the field of light emitting devices, and also to the field of household appliances, such as electromagnetic hair removal devices comprising light emitting devices. Background technique [0002] Laser hair removal or laser hair removal techniques are commonly used to remove hair from a person's skin or even prevent the growth of new hair. In certain wavelength regions of electromagnetic radiation, the electromagnetic absorption of the hair, in particular the hair root, is greater than the absorption of the surrounding skin. Thus, when the skin is treated with light in a selected wavelength range, the hair roots may be selectively heated to temperatures above 60° C., resulting in a loss of the hair roots' ability to grow new hairs. Thus, light treatment may allow for the control of hair growth on human skin.
